Maybe try to add more copies of boss and maybe a pal pad. You need more supporters that have less impactful effects on your hand. Maybe a Worker or Avery.

NoGoodNames avatar

Yeah, just having Prof. might hurt you with the Wigglytuff if you plan to use that a lot, a shuffle card might be better in this deck.

Marco_Ne avatar

Oinkologne is cool, but you don't really need 2 stage one lines alongside the gigas, maybe remove those and add some regigigas vstar because it's also a good attacker
